A potters delight
My Dear, I am a master potter and I love to make wondrous creations. The first step is good clay; you are the clay.
Do not become dry clay little one; I know exactly what you need to become good clay in my hands. You need living water to satisfy and quench your thirst. Yet sometimes you look in every other place, high and low with great angst you seek… but I know it will not fill, it will not make you of good substance. Becoming too dry or too hard or too soft.
My Plan for you is for you to become all that you can be made into, all that you were created to be – a masterpiece, intricate in design, depth and character, no flaws, no cracks, fully sealed with my son Jesus. And when I pour into you, instead of leaking through the cracks or falling apart – you will overflow like a fountain.
A fountain that radiates in the sun and draws many people close by the peaceful and calming sounds of its living and sustaining water. I am life child and you will become life to others when you are filled with the spirit to mimic all you know and learn of me.
Relax in my arms and in my presence, for then I can easily mould you, trust me and remember who I am and what you are! For willing clay is a potters delight!
Lastly, remember that when its hottest and the hardest is when I am working most beautifully, refining and strengthening through the flame and the kiln, so that you may come out the other side strong, beautiful and purposefully designed with your makers seal and mark.
